JobHistory should enable history collection after a timeout or some other event -------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Key: MAPREDUCE-1763 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/MAPREDUCE-1763 Project: Hadoop Map/Reduce Issue Type: Improvement Components: jobtracker Affects Versions: 0.20.1 Reporter: Alex Kozlov Priority: Critical If you search for disableHistory in JobHistory.java, one can discover that it is enabled only at the initialization time. There are two instances where job history can be disabled: * if it fails to initialize the the output directories * If it fails to create a single job history file There are a few problems with that. One is that there is no way to revert the flag even if the original problem goes away. Second, these cases should probably be handled separately. The result of which is that once the job history file creation fails, the job history mechanism becomes disabled and there is no way to switch it back. One simple solution is to have a timeout after which we can try to enable the job history collection. Another is to have a more granular job history control per job.
